1. The Early Times: Prohibition and Underground Gambling
Within the early times of recent civilization, gambling was usually viewed with suspicion and moral disdain. Lots of societies deemed gambling a vice, associating it with criminal offense, ethical decay, and social instability. This led to rigid prohibitions versus gambling in different varieties throughout numerous international locations. In America, for instance, gambling was mostly banned because of the early twentieth century, with most states outlawing it in all types. This led on the increase of underground gambling dens and speakeasies, in which gambling transpired illegally beneath the Charge of structured criminal offense.

In the same way, in Europe, numerous nations taken care of rigid prohibitions from gambling perfectly into the nineteenth and early twentieth generations. These bans were being often rooted in religious and ethical objections to gambling, as well as issues about social order and public well being. In the United Kingdom, for instance, gambling was heavily limited, with the exception of non-public golf equipment and significant Culture functions, which allowed gambling to continue in a far more discreet manner.

The prohibition era produced a black market for gambling, the place illicit casinos flourished, generally underneath the protection of criminal organizations. This underground gambling scene became a significant supply of income for arranged crime, which further more entrenched the detrimental social perceptions of gambling.

2. The Change to Regulation: Recognizing Financial Possible
By the mid-twentieth century, attitudes toward gambling started to shift. Governments begun recognizing the economic possible of gambling to be a legit market that may deliver important revenue as a result of taxes and tourism. This shift in standpoint marked the start of a more controlled approach to gambling, wherever governments sought to control and take pleasure in the market rather than ban it outright.

Nevada was the primary U.S. state to completely embrace this change. In 1931, Nevada legalized On line casino gambling like a technique to combat the economic hardships of The good Despair and to capitalize about the growing curiosity in Las Vegas for a vacationer location. This bold go paved the way to the institution of Las Vegas given that the "Gambling Capital of the entire world" and established a precedent for other locations to consider the economic benefits of regulated gambling.

Adhering to Nevada's example, other U.S. states and nations around the world started to rethink their gambling guidelines. In Europe, Monaco capitalized on this change by reworking Monte Carlo right into a glamorous gambling desired destination, attracting rich tourists from across the continent. In the United Kingdom, the Betting and Gaming Act of 1960 legalized betting shops and bingo halls, laying the groundwork for a more controlled gambling surroundings.

3. The Rise of Casino Resorts and Contemporary Regulation
The second half from the 20th century observed an extra evolution of On line casino legislation, with the emergence of On line casino resorts as important financial drivers. Nations and regions that experienced Beforehand shunned gambling started to check out its likely for a Instrument for financial progress, specially in tourism and amusement. This period was marked by the event of enormous-scale, integrated resorts that put together casinos with motels, searching malls, theaters, and convention facilities, developing thorough enjoyment Places.

Macau's determination inside the early 2000s to finish its casino monopoly and invite overseas operators to produce integrated resorts marked a big turning level in the get more info evolution of On line casino regulations. This shift transformed Macau into the whole world's premier gambling hub, surpassing Las Vegas when it comes to earnings. The good results of Macau's controlled casino market place shown the prospective great things about a effectively-controlled gambling sector, attracting investment decision, building Employment, and boosting tourism.

In Singapore, The federal government took a careful but strategic approach to casino legalization, opening its current market to 2 integrated resorts in 2010—Marina Bay Sands and Resorts Planet Sentosa. These resorts ended up subject to rigid regulatory oversight, with actions set up to market responsible gambling and decrease social harms. Singapore's design of really managed, limited casino growth grew to become a reference place for other nations around the world contemplating the introduction or growth of casino gambling.

4. Present day Regulatory Frameworks: Balancing Gains and Risks
These days, casino legal guidelines and rules are characterized by a stability amongst maximizing economic Positive aspects and minimizing social hazards. Present day regulatory frameworks typically center on a number of important locations: licensing and taxation, customer protection, responsible gambling, and anti-money laundering.

Licensing and Taxation: Governments use licensing to be a Software to manage the quantity of casinos working inside their jurisdiction and to make sure that operators meet sure benchmarks. Licenses will often be issued based upon competitive bids, with operators needed to display their capability to handle a On line casino responsibly and ethically. In return for the best to operate, On line casino operators are typically issue to varied forms of taxation, together with gaming taxes, corporate taxes, and native taxes, offering substantial earnings for public coffers.

Purchaser Safety and Liable Gambling: Present day On line casino rules place a powerful emphasis on consumer defense and liable gambling. This consists of steps to prevent challenge gambling, like self-exclusion applications, obligatory breaks, spending limitations, and considerable marketing constraints. Lots of jurisdictions demand casinos to offer specifics of the hazards of gambling and to supply aid solutions for individuals combating dependancy. The goal is to create a safer gambling surroundings even though allowing for customers to take pleasure in gaming responsibly.

Anti-Income Laundering (AML): Casinos will often be at risk of being used for money laundering as a result of massive volumes of cash that circulation by way of their operations. To overcome this, present day rules impose stringent AML necessities on casinos, which include purchaser research, transaction monitoring, and reporting of suspicious routines. These laws are created to avoid casinos from becoming exploited by criminals and to protect the integrity of the financial procedure.

five. Problems and Controversies in Modern day Casino Regulation
Regardless of the improvements in regulatory frameworks, modern day casino regulation just isn't with out its challenges and controversies. Amongst the principal difficulties is balancing the financial advantages of casinos Using the opportunity social expenditures. Although casinos can provide substantial financial benefits, for instance job generation and tourism profits, they can also result in negative social outcomes, which include trouble gambling, economic hardship, and enhanced crime charges.

In addition, You can find the challenge of regulatory capture and corruption. The lucrative character of your casino marketplace may result in attempts to influence regulatory bodies and policymakers, increasing considerations about fairness and transparency during the licensing and regulation processes.

The quick advancement of on the web gambling also offers new regulatory challenges. On the web casinos run throughout borders, rendering it tough for almost any solitary place to control them successfully. This has resulted in calls for increased Global cooperation and harmonization of gambling laws to address the distinctive problems posed with the digital age.
